Time for the secondary wave from the source to the station is  {{{d/275}}} minutes, where d is the distance from the source to the station.


Time for the primary wave from the source to the station is  {{{d/(1.7*275)}}} minutes, where d is the same distance from the source to the station.


Your equation is


{{{d/275}}} - {{{d/(1.7*275)}}} = 5.07 minutes   (the "time difference" equation).


From the equation


d = {{{5.07/(1/275 - 1/(1.7*275))}}} = (at this point I use Excel spreadsheet in my computer) = 3386 kilometers.


<U>Answer</U>.  The distance from the source to the station is 3386 kilometers.
